On September 4, the main race of the 2022 F1 Dutch Grand Prix was staged passionately at the Zandwater Circuit. After a fierce competition of 72 laps, finally, Verstappen from Red Bull team won the championship, Russell from Mercedes team, and Leclerc from Ferrari team.
According to yesterday's qualifying results, the top ten drivers are: Verstappen, Leclerc, Sainz, Hamilton, Perez, Russell, Norris, Mick Schumacher, Kakuda Yuui, and Stor.
The red light went out and the game started. Verstappen, who started the pole position, held his position and led the way through Turn 1. The positions of Leclerc, Sainz, Hamilton and Perez did not change. Russell, who started the sixth place, was overtaken by Norris behind him and fell to seventh.
On lap 4, Russell overtook Norris back to sixth at the end of the straight.
On the 15th lap, Sainz entered the station, replaced the soft tire, and replaced the neutral tire, but his tire replacement took up 12.7 seconds and was surpassed by Perez in the station. After leaving the station, Sainz fell to eleventh.

On the 18th lap, Leclerc entered the station, replaced the soft tire, and replaced the neutral tire. After leaving the station, Leclerc fell to fourth place.
On the 19th lap, Verstappen entered the station, and also replaced the soft tire and replaced the neutral tire. After leaving the station, Verstappen fell to third place, ranking behind Hamilton and Russell, who had not yet entered the station with the neutral tire.
On the 28th lap, Verstappen overtook Russell at the end of the straight and reached second.
On the 30th lap, Hamilton entered the station, replaced the neutral tire, replaced the hard tire, and fell to fifth place after leaving the station, ranking behind Perez.
On lap 31, Russell entered the station and also replaced the neutral tire and the hard tire. After leaving the station, Russell fell to fifth place, ranking behind teammate Hamilton.
At this time, the top ten on the field are: Verstappen, Leclerc, Perez, Hamilton, Russell, Sainz, Norris, Stor, Alonso, and Ocon.
On the 36th lap, Hamilton caught up with Perez and wanted to take action at the end of the straight, but Perez once again staged a tenacious defense.
After one lap, Hamilton took action at the end of the straight again, and this time he finally surpassed the past. Hamilton went to third and Perez fell to fourth.
On lap 39, Russell overtook Perez and reached fourth.
On the 41st lap, Perez stopped for the second time, replaced the neutral tire, and replaced the hard tire. After leaving the station, Perez fell to seventh and ranked behind Norris.
On the 44th lap, Perez overtakes Norris and reaches fifth.
At this time, Yuki Kakuda's racing car was parked next to the track, but after some operation, his racing car was restarted, so there was no safe car.
On the 46th lap, Leclerc stopped for the second time, and after leaving the station, he fell behind Russell, ranking fourth.
On the 47th lap, Yuki Kakuda was unable to continue the race and stopped by the track. The tournament dispatched a virtual safety car, which was extremely beneficial to Verstappen, who had not yet stopped twice.
Sure enough, Verstappen took the opportunity to complete the entry, replaced the neutral tire, and replaced it with a hard tire. After leaving the station, he was still in the leading position.
match reached lap 50. At this time, the top ten on the court were: Verstappen, Hamilton, Russell, Leclerc, Perez, Ocon, Sainz, Norris, Alonso, and Stole.
On the 55th lap, Botas's car suddenly stopped at the end of the straight road. The race first showed the yellow flag, and then drove the safety car.
Verstappen entered the station and replaced it with soft tires. All the drivers also entered the station and replaced it with soft tires, but two Mercedes cars did not enter the station. After Verstappen left the station, he fell behind Hamilton and Russell.
Then, Russell entered the station, replaced it with a soft tire, and fell behind Verstappen after leaving the station. Hamilton, who was in the leading position, continued to stay on the track.
Sainz was unsafely released by the team when he entered the station, which almost caused Alonso behind him to rear-end, and Sainz was fined 5 seconds.
On lap 60, the safety car exited and the race restarted. Then Verstappen overtook Hamilton at the end of the straight and returned to the leading position.
On the 64th lap, Russell overtook Hamilton and went to second place.
On the 66th lap, Leclerc overtook Hamilton and reached third.
In the end, Verstappen took the lead in crossing the line, Russell and Leclerc followed closely. After Sainz was fined 5 seconds, he dropped from fifth to eighth. Therefore, the points drivers from fourth to tenth are: Hamilton, Perez, Alonso, Norris, Sainz, O'Conn, and Stole.
